As I delve into the delightful world of “Miss Nelson Is Missing!”, I can’t help but feel a wave of nostalgia wash over me. This classic children’s book, written by Harry G. Allard and illustrated by James Marshall, is not just a story; it’s an experience that brilliantly captures the chaos and charm of a classroom setting. The premise revolves around a group of misbehaving students and their sweet, caring teacher, Miss Nelson, who mysteriously disappears, leaving behind a stern substitute teacher, Miss Viola Swamp. This clever twist makes the book not only entertaining but also a valuable lesson about respect and the importance of appreciating those who care for us.

The full-color ink and wash illustrations are simply stunning and bring the characters to life in a way that keeps young readers engaged. James Marshall’s art is playful yet expressive, perfectly complementing the story’s humor and warmth.
